The Four LED States

The Four LED States — What Each One Means and What It Requires in Trooper, PA

State One — Both LEDs Solid — Sensor System Not the Cause in Trooper

Both sensor LEDs solid indicates the transmitter is producing the infrared beam and the receiver is correctly detecting it in Trooper, PA. The sensor system is functioning correctly in Trooper. If the door still won't close with both LEDs solid, the sensor system is not the cause of the won't-close symptom in Trooper, PA. EZ Open moves to the next step in the won't-close diagnostic hierarchy in Trooper. Down-travel limit setting assessment. Physical obstruction check. Spring balance and force limit assessment in Trooper, PA.

State Two — Receiver LED Blinking, Transmitter LED Solid — Misalignment or Obstruction in Trooper, PA

The transmitter is producing the beam, its LED is solid, in Trooper. The receiver isn't correctly detecting the full beam, its LED is blinking, in Trooper, PA. This state indicates one of three possible causes in Trooper. The receiver sensor bracket has rotated out of correct alignment and the beam isn't hitting the receiver lens. A physical obstruction between the two sensors is blocking the beam in Trooper, PA. Or sunlight is hitting the receiver lens at an angle that overwhelms the receiver's ability to detect the transmitter's beam against the solar background in Trooper.

State Three — Receiver LED Off, Transmitter LED Solid — Wiring or Power Fault at Receiver in Trooper

The transmitter has power, its LED is solid, in Trooper, PA. The receiver has no power, its LED is completely off, in Trooper. A completely off LED indicates no power reaching the sensor unit in Trooper, PA. The most common cause is a break in the wiring between the receiver sensor and the opener control board in Trooper. The break may be from a staple driven through the wire during installation, a rodent chew, a physical disturbance that kinked or cut the wire, or a loose connection at the control board terminal in Trooper, PA.

State Four — Both LEDs Off — No Power to Either Sensor in Trooper, PA

Both LEDs off indicates no power reaching either sensor in Trooper. The most common cause is a loose or disconnected connection at the sensor terminal on the opener control board where both sensor wires connect in Trooper, PA. Both sensors share the same power supply from the opener in Trooper. If the connection that supplies power to both sensors is loose or disconnected, both sensors lose power simultaneously in Trooper, PA.

The Bracket Adjustment Test

The Bracket Adjustment Test — How EZ Open Distinguishes Misalignment From Failure in Trooper, PA

What the Bracket Adjustment Test Involves in Trooper

The bracket adjustment test is performed when the receiver LED is blinking and no physical obstruction is visible between the two sensors in Trooper, PA. The receiver sensor bracket is gently adjusted through its complete range of angular positions while the receiver LED is continuously observed in Trooper. The bracket is moved through every angle at which the receiver lens could potentially receive the transmitter's beam in Trooper, PA. The test takes approximately sixty to ninety seconds to complete through the full bracket range in Trooper.

What a Positive Result Tells Us — The Sensor Is Functional in Trooper, PA

If the receiver LED becomes solid at any point during the bracket adjustment, at any angle within the bracket's range of motion, the sensor's internal photoelectric component is functional in Trooper. The sensor is correctly detecting the transmitter's beam when the beam is correctly aligned with the receiver lens in Trooper, PA. The cause of the blinking LED was misalignment of the bracket rather than failure of the sensor component in Trooper. The bracket is locked in the position where the LED became solid in Trooper, PA. No sensor replacement is needed in Trooper.

What a Negative Result Tells Us — The Sensor Has Failed in Trooper, PA

If the receiver LED stays blinking through the complete range of bracket adjustment with no physical obstruction between the sensors in Trooper, the sensor's internal photoelectric component has failed in Trooper, PA. The component isn't detecting the transmitter's beam at any angle because it can no longer detect infrared radiation at the transmitter's frequency in Trooper. The sensor requires replacement in Trooper, PA. EZ Open carries compatible replacement sensors for all major opener brands in Trooper.

Every Sensor Fault EZ Open Diagnoses and Repairs

Every Sensor Fault EZ Open Diagnoses and Repairs in Trooper, PA

Sensor Bracket Misalignment From Physical Contact or Vibration in Trooper

The sensor bracket is designed to be adjustable for installation in Trooper, PA. That adjustability also means the bracket can rotate out of correct alignment from physical contact with a person, object, or vehicle that bumps the sensor or the bracket during garage use in Trooper. Door operation vibration over years of cycling can also slowly rotate the bracket away from its correct angle in Trooper, PA. The bracket adjustment test confirms misalignment as the cause in Trooper. Bracket adjustment and locking in the correct position resolves the fault in Trooper, PA.

Physical Obstruction Between the Sensors in Trooper

An object positioned in the path between the two sensors at floor level blocks the infrared beam and produces the same blinking receiver LED as misalignment in Trooper, PA. A tool, a piece of equipment, a floor mat shifted into the path, or debris accumulation at the door threshold in Trooper. Removing the obstruction restores correct beam transmission in Trooper, PA.

Solar Interference — The Time-of-Day Fault in Trooper, PA

Direct sunlight entering the garage can contain sufficient infrared radiation to overwhelm the receiver's ability to detect the transmitter's specific beam against the solar background in Trooper. The symptom occurs only when the sun is at a specific angle that directs sunlight onto the receiver lens in Trooper, PA. The time-of-day pattern is the identifying characteristic in Trooper. A door that won't close in the afternoon but closes correctly in the morning and evening is almost certainly experiencing solar interference in Trooper, PA.

Wiring Fault Between Sensor and Opener Control Board in Trooper

The low-voltage wiring connecting each sensor to the opener control board runs from the sensor bracket up the door frame and along the ceiling to the opener unit in Trooper, PA. Any break, short circuit, or poor connection along this run produces sensor LED behavior that appears identical to sensor misalignment or failure in Trooper. EZ Open inspects the complete wiring run where an off LED or persistent blinking LED doesn't respond to bracket adjustment in Trooper, PA.

Sensor Component Failure — When Replacement Is Actually Required in Trooper, PA

A sensor with a failed internal photoelectric component requires replacement in Trooper. The component failure is confirmed by the negative result of the bracket adjustment test, the receiver LED stays blinking through the complete bracket range with no obstruction between the sensors in Trooper, PA. Replacement with a compatible sensor for the specific opener brand restores correct function in Trooper.

Opener Control Board Fault Producing Sensor-Like Symptoms in Trooper, PA

In specific cases, a fault in the opener control board itself produces symptoms that appear identical to a sensor fault in Trooper. The board may incorrectly interpret the sensor signal as a beam interruption when the sensor is correctly functioning in Trooper, PA. EZ Open identifies control board involvement through elimination of all sensor-level causes in Trooper.

Why Bypassing the Sensor Is Never the Correct Response

Why Bypassing the Sensor Is Never the Correct Response in Trooper, PA

What the 1992 Federal Mandate Was Responding To in Trooper

The Consumer Product Safety Commission's 1992 mandate requiring entrapment protection on all residential garage door openers was issued in response to a documented pattern of children being struck and in some cases fatally injured by closing garage doors in Trooper, PA. The automatic reversal provided by the sensor system was specifically designed to address the scenario where a child enters the door path during a closing cycle initiated by an adult who doesn't see the child in Trooper.

What the Hold-Button Method Actually Removes From the Safety System in Trooper, PA

Holding the wall button to close the door when the sensor is faulty switches the opener to a supervised manual close mode in Trooper. In this mode, the automatic beam-interruption reversal is not active in Trooper, PA. If the beam is interrupted during the close cycle because a child has entered the door path, the door does not reverse automatically in Trooper. Visual observation and human reaction time are not adequate substitutes for the automatic beam-interruption reversal in Trooper, PA.

The Specific Scenario the Sensor Protects Against in Trooper

An adult initiates the close cycle from inside the garage and begins walking toward the house in Trooper, PA. A child who was outside enters the garage from the street as the door is closing in Trooper. The adult's back is turned and the child is below the adult's field of view in Trooper, PA. The sensor beam is broken by the child entering the door path in Trooper. The opener reverses the door immediately in Trooper, PA. This scenario requires the sensor to be functional in Trooper.
